Remote WinRM Resort Breach: Penetration Assessment Techniques
Successfully simulating a "WinRM Casino Heist" requires a meticulous plan to security assessment. Initial reconnaissance often begins with identifying publicly exposed WinRM ports, frequently through unobtrusive network scanning. Exploitation could involve utilizing credential stuffing against common administrative accounts or taking advantage of known vulnerabilities read more in older WinRM versions. Lateral movement, mimicking malicious employees, is vital – post-exploitation techniques might include harvesting user credentials from memory using tools like Mimikatz, discovering valuable assets within the network, and ultimately compromising systems controlling gaming data. The assessment should also include attempting to bypass security controls, like multi-factor authentication, using techniques such as pass-the-hash or intercepting attacks. Finally, exhaustive documentation and reporting are crucial to demonstrate weaknesses and ensure remediation.
Windows Remote Management Casino Security: Fortifying Your Remote Gaming
The burgeoning online casino industry presents unique challenges regarding security, particularly when considering remote access for staff and support. WinRM, Windows Remote Management protocol, is often employed for managing these environments, but its incorrect setup can introduce significant risks. Guaranteeing proper WinRM verification, limiting access permissions, and regularly inspecting configurations are crucial steps in avoiding unauthorized access and shielding the integrity of digital gambling operations. Neglecting WinRM protection can lead to significant outcomes, including data exposures and monetary harm.
